When a weight-tracked container is marked as "Finished" in VetSnap, the system automatically calculates how much of the drug should remain in the bottle. This is based on three key inputs:

  • The Open Bottle Weight

  • The Final Bottle Weight

  • The Mass-to-Quantity Conversion value set for that container

Using these, LogButler determines the expected remaining quantity. The Calculated Manufacturer Overage or Underage reflects any difference between the expected and actual remaining amount.

If you see a large discrepancy, it may indicate that the mass-to-quantity conversion value entered for that drug is incorrect and should be reviewed.
